ASP.NET Web Dev:将一个目录映射到另一个目录?

时间:2008-10-09 17:15:31

标签: asp.net iis

我们正在考虑将我们的Web目录架构重命名为更加用户友好。但是,我们需要对旧目录结构的任何URL请求转发到新目录结构。所以....

如何转发所有这些请求:

http://mydomain.com/OLDdirname/

http://mydomain.com/OLDdirname/samesubdir/

http://mydomain.com/OLDdirname/samesubdir/samescript.aspx

分别为

中的每一个:

http://mydomain.com/NEWdirname/

http://mydomain.com/NEWdirname/samesubdir/

http://mydomain.com/NEWdirname/samesubdir/samescript.aspx

就陷阱而言,有任何建议,也许还有一些一般性的指导意见吗?

2 个答案:

答案 0 :(得分:4)

您可以使用许多东西来做这样的事情。基本上,你正在进行URL重写。其中一种产品可以帮助您完成工作:

答案 1 :(得分:2)

我在我的许多网站上都使用了IIRF,它一直在不失败的情况下工作。您可以使用正则表达式来定义规则,并完成其余的操作。使用IIRF设置一些重定向非常容易。

http://cheeso.members.winisp.net/IIRF.aspx